The Beginnings of Coffee: An International Point of view



While you could assume of coffee as a modern staple, its beginnings trace back centuries, linking with cultures throughout the globe. The tale starts in Ethiopia, where tale says a goat herder called Kaldi uncovered the energizing effects of coffee beans after discovering his goats romping energetically after consuming them. This stimulated passion, causing coffee's infect Arab investors who treasured the made drink. By the 15th century, it got to Persia, Egypt, and Turkey, where coffeehouses became social centers for conversation and culture.As trade courses broadened, coffee made its way to Europe in the 17th century, quickly getting appeal. It transformed from a mystical drink into a day-to-day ritual, inspiring gatherings and intellectual exchanges. Each culture added its one-of-a-kind spin to coffee preparation, enriching its history. This worldwide journey highlights exactly how coffee links us, transcending boundaries and uniting varied customs via a basic bean.

Growing and Harvesting of Espresso Beans



As coffee's journey advanced, the emphasis moved to the cultivation and harvesting of certain bean selections, particularly those made use of for espresso. You'll find that espresso beans often come from Arabica or Robusta plants, each offering unique flavors. The ideal expanding conditions consist of high altitudes and rich, well-drained dirt, which enhance the beans' quality.During the harvest, picking methods differ. In some regions, employees hand-pick ripe cherries, making certain just the ideal fruit goes to handling. In various other areas, mechanical farmers are used, specifically on bigger ranches. Timing is crucial; you wish to gather when the cherries get to peak ripeness for maximum flavor.Once collected, the beans are gotten ready for handling, which is essential in establishing their last preference. Understanding the growing and harvesting procedures offers you understanding into what enters into your favored espresso, enriching your appreciation for every cup.

Gathering Methods Described



When it pertains to coffee, understanding harvesting strategies is necessary, considering that they directly impact the flavor and top quality of the beans you delight in. There are two main techniques: discerning picking and strip picking - SOE. Careful selecting includes hand-picking only ripe cherries, ensuring you obtain the very best high quality beans. This method often leads to a richer taste profile, though it's even more labor-intensive. On the various other hand, strip picking ways collecting all cherries simultaneously, despite ripeness. While it's quicker and more affordable, this can cause a mix of tastes, influencing the last product. Ultimately, the option of harvesting strategy can substantially influence your coffee experience, so it's worth knowing just how those beans made it to your cup


Fermentation and Drying out



After gathering, the next steps in processing coffee beans play a significant duty fit their taste. You'll discover that fermentation is essential, as it aids break down the mucilage bordering the beans, improving their taste account. Depending upon the technique, this process can last from a few hours to numerous days, with varying results based upon temperature and humidity.Once fermentation is total, drying out complies with, which is equally vital. You can select from mechanical or sun-drying drying out techniques. Sun-drying allows the beans to soak up tastes from the environment, while mechanical drying out assurances regular moisture levels no matter of climate. Appropriate drying is necessary to prevent mold and protect the beans' quality, inevitably influencing your mug of coffee.


Milling and Grading Process



As fermentation and drying established the phase for taste growth, the milling and grading process warranties that just the very best coffee beans make it to your cup. This stage entails eliminating the outer layers of the coffee cherry, including the parchment and husk. After milling, the beans are sorted by size and weight, making certain an uniform top quality. You'll find that grading assists recognize defects and classify beans, which affects taste and aroma. Premium beans obtain a greater quality, leading to a richer coffee experience. Once graded, the beans are prepared for packaging and delivery, protecting their distinct attributes. This careful process is vital for delivering the extraordinary preference you enjoy in every sip of your favored mixture.

Toasting Approaches Discussed



While you might assume that all coffee toasting approaches yield the same outcomes, the truth is that each method exposes special flavor potentials in the beans. You can select in between approaches like drum roasting, air roasting, or also typical pan roasting. Drum toasting uses a turning drum to uniformly distribute heat, improving caramelization and producing a well balanced taste. Air roasting, on the various other hand, distributes hot air around the beans, advertising a lighter roast with pronounced level of acidity. Frying pan toasting allows for hands-on control yet needs constant focus to stay clear of burning. Each approach has its nuances, so trying out various strategies can help you find the perfect roast that lines up with your taste preferences. Influence on Taste Account



Different roasting approaches not just affect the process but also considerably affect the taste account of the coffee beans. When you choose a light roast, you'll experience intense acidity and floral notes, showcasing the bean's beginning. In contrast, a medium roast equilibriums acidity with sweet taste, usually exposing chocolatey touches. Dark roasts, on the other hand, draw out strong, great smoky flavors, occasionally covering up the read here bean's distinct characteristics. Each technique reveals various oils and compounds, resulting in a wide range of flavors. By try out various roasting styles, you can uncover which accounts resonate with your taste. Understanding these subtleties assists you appreciate the virtuosity behind your cup of coffee, improving your overall experience with every sip.

Brewing Approaches: Exactly How Prep Work Impacts Flavor



Mixing coffee opens up a domain of flavor possibilities, however how you brew that blend can considerably influence your final mug. Various brewing approaches remove distinct flavors and scents, so it's critical to select intelligently. A French press allows oils and debris to remain, creating a rich, full-bodied experience. On the other hand, a pour-over highlights the coffee's clearness and brightness, excellent for showcasing delicate notes.Espresso, with its high stress, generates a focused shot that accentuates sweet taste and crema. If you prefer a lighter mixture, think about a cool mixture technique; it produces a smooth, much less acidic taste.Ultimately, trial and error is crucial. Adjusting variables like water temperature level, grind dimension, and brew time can transform your coffee's profile. So, accept the art of brewing to find the directory tastes concealed in your coffee blends. The right approach can boost your experience to new elevations.

What Is the Distinction Between Arabica and Robusta Beans?



Arabica beans are smoother, sweeter, and have a higher level of acidity, while robusta beans are stronger, more bitter, and have more caffeine. You'll observe these differences in flavor and scent when brewing your coffee.


Just How Does Altitude Affect Coffee Bean Flavor?



Altitude influences coffee bean flavor substantially. Greater altitudes produce beans with brighter acidity and complicated tastes, while reduced altitudes usually produce beans that are heavier and less nuanced. You'll discover these differences in your mug!

Just how Should I Shop Coffee Beans for Quality?



To maintain your coffee beans fresh, keep them in an airtight container in an amazing, dark place. Avoid exposing them to warm, light, or moisture, as these aspects can rapidly weaken their taste and aroma.
